Abstract

There is disclosed a dual axis tracking system ( 200 ) comprising a support structure ( 300 ) for supporting at least one solar device ( 1 ); a movable carriage frame ( 353 ) pivotally coupled to the support structure ( 300 ); at least one carrier arm ( 351 ) pivotally coupled to the support structure ( 300 ) and to the movable carriage frame ( 353 ). Each carrier arm ( 351 ) is adapted to hold or support a plurality of carrier arms ( 351 ) and other solar devices such as reflecting means or the likes. A motion assembly ( 352 ) pivotally coupled to the carriage frame ( 353 ) for providing movements to the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the carrier arm ( 351 ); wherein the motion assembly ( 352 ) comprises at least one telescopic member ( 352 a ) and a track assembly ( 352 b ). The orientations or movements of the solar devices ( 1 ) are generally in response to the motions provided by the motion assembly ( 352 ) in cooperation with the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the carrier arm ( 351 ).

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A dual axis tracking system ( 200 ) comprising:
 a support structure ( 300 ) for supporting at least one solar device ( 1 ) comprising at least two horizontal members ( 301 , 302 ), at least one transverse post ( 308 ) secured at a central region of the support structure ( 300 ) and a movable carriage frame ( 353 ) pivotally coupled to the horizontal members ( 301 ,  302 );   at least one carrier ( 351 ) pivotally coupled to at least one of the horizontal members ( 301 ,  302 ) and to the movable carriage frame ( 353 ); said carrier arm ( 351 ) for holding at least one solar device ( 1 );   a motion assembly ( 352 ) pivotally coupled to the carriage frame ( 353 ) for providing movements to the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the carrier arm ( 351 );
 wherein the motion assembly ( 352 ) comprises at least one telescopic member ( 352   a ) and a track assembly ( 352   b ); said track assembly ( 352   b ) comprising at least one sliding member ( 40 ) being slidably connected to a sliding track ( 41 ); 
 wherein the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is pivotally and slidably coupled to the motion assembly ( 352 ) and in a manner such that a lower section of the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is slidable on the sliding member ( 40 ); and that the lower section of the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is movable laterally or forward and backward; 
 wherein the solar device ( 1 ) varying orientations or movements are in response to the motions provided by the motion assembly ( 352 ) in cooperation with the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the carrier arm ( 351 ). 
   
     
     
         2 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the movable carriage frame ( 353 ) is pivotally coupled to the horizontal posts ( 301 ,  302 ) in such a way that it is downwardly suspended from said horizontal posts ( 301 ,  302 ). 
     
     
         3 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the carrier arm ( 351 ) comprises an upper section ( 351   a ) for holding the solar device ( 1 ) and a lower section ( 351   b ) that extends downwardly and is pivotally connected to at least one section of the carriage frame ( 353 ). 
     
     
         4 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the carriage frame ( 353 ) comprises at least two horizontally positioned lateral posts ( 17 ,  18 ) and two middle posts ( 19 ,  20 ). 
     
     
         5 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 4 , wherein each carrier arm ( 351 ) is pivotally coupled to the lateral posts ( 17 ,  18 ) of the carriage frame ( 353 ). 
     
     
         6 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is pivotally coupled to the transverse post ( 308 ), carriage frame ( 353 ) and sliding member ( 40 ) by way of concentric rings connectors ( 70   a,    70   b,    71   a,    71   b,    72   a,    72   b ), in a manner such that the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is able to be compressible and also move in accordance with the motion provided by the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the sliding member ( 40 ). 
     
     
         7 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 6  wherein the telescopic member ( 352   a ) slides through into the second concentric ring connector ( 71   a,    71   b ) and terminates at the first concentric ring connector ( 70   a,    70   b ). 
     
     
         8 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ein an upper section of the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is pivotally coupled to the transverse post ( 308 ), a middle section is pivotally coupled to the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the lower section is pivotally and slidably coupled to the sliding member ( 40 ). 
     
     
         9 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the support structure ( 300 ) further comprising a plurality of vertical posts to hold up the horizontal posts ( 301 ,  302 ). 
     
     
         10 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the sliding member ( 40 ) comprises two elongated members ( 40   a,    40   b ) being horizontally positioned and held in position by an inverted U shaped structure or member ( 40   c ) whereby each end of said elongated members is provided with at least one roller means ( 52 , 53 , 54 , 55 ) so as to enable these elongated members to be slidably connected to the sliding track ( 41 ). 
     
     
         11 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 6  wherein the concentric rings connector ( 70   a,    70   b,    71   a,    71   b,    72   a,    72   b ) comprises two ring-shape members, whereby at least one is adapted to be an inner ring ( 70   a,    71   a,    72   a ) and another is adapted to be the outer ring ( 70   b,    71   b,    72   b ); whereby said inner ring is movably connected within the outer ring and thus both rings share the same axial point. 
     
     
         12 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 6  wherein telescopic member ( 352   a ) is further connected by a mounting member ( 25 ); said mounting member ( 25 ) comprising a pair of disc shape members ( 25   a,    25   b ) formed with peripheral external ridge and a corresponding central opening on both disc members ( 25   a,    25   b ) sized sufficiently to receive the telescopic member ( 352   a ). 
     
     
         13 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 12  wherein at least one mounting member ( 25 ) is pivotally disposed on the telescopic member ( 352   a ) within the inner ring of the concentric rings connector ( 70   a,    70   b,    71   a,    71   b,    72   a,    72   b ). 
     
     
         14 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claims 1  to  3  wherein the upper section of the carrier arm ( 351   a)  is pivotally connected to the horizontal post ( 301 ,  302 ) by a connector ( 92 ); said connector ( 92 ) comprises two main sections, a first section being a tubular hollow member and the second section is generally an inverted U-shaped body defining a bracket for securement of the upper section ( 351   a ) of the carrier arm ( 351 ) to the respective horizontal member ( 301 ,  302 ). 
     
     
         15 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the motion assembly ( 352 ) further comprising two motor units ( 352   c,    352   d ); wherein one motor unit ( 352   c ) is connected to provide movement for the sliding member ( 40 ) and another motor unit ( 352   d ) is adapted to provide sliding movement for the lower section of the telescopic member ( 352   a ) on the sliding member ( 40 ). 
     
     
         16 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1  wherein there is provided a plurality of carrier arms ( 351 ) mounted to the horizontal posts ( 301 ,  302 ) and each carrier arm ( 351 ) carries a plurality of solar devices ( 1 ,  2 ). 
     
     
         17 . The solar tracking system ( 200 ) as claimed in  claim 1  wherein a first motion for the solar device ( 1 ) is accomplished based on the forward and backward movement of the sliding member ( 40 ) along the length of the posts of the sliding track ( 41 ) and a second motion is accomplished based on the movement of the lower section of the telescopic member ( 352   a ) along the sliding member ( 40 ). 
     
     
         18 . A dual axis solar tracking system ( 200 ) comprising:
 a support structure ( 300 ) for supporting a plurality of solar devices ( 1 ) comprising at least two horizontal members ( 301 , 302 ), at least one transverse post ( 305 ) secured horizontally at a central region of the support structure ( 300 ) and a movable carriage frame ( 353 );   a plurality of carrier arms ( 351 ) pivotally coupled to at least one of the horizontal members ( 301 ,  302 ) and to the movable carriage frame ( 353 ); said carrier arm ( 351 ) for holding at least two solar devices ( 1 );   a motion assembly ( 352 ) pivotally coupled to the carriage frame ( 353 ) for providing movements to the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the carrier arm ( 351 );   wherein the motion assembly ( 352 ) comprises at least one telescopic member ( 352   a ) and a track assembly ( 352   b ); said track assembly ( 352   b ) comprising at least one sliding member ( 40 ) being slidably connected to a sliding track ( 41 );   wherein the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is pivotally and slidably coupled to the motion assembly ( 352 ) and in a manner such that a lower section of the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is slidable on the sliding member ( 40 ); and that the lower section of the telescopic member ( 352   a ) is movable laterally or forward and backward;   wherein the solar device ( 1 ) varying orientations or movements are in response to the motions provided by the motion assembly ( 352 ) in cooperation with the carriage frame ( 353 ) and the carrier arm ( 351 ).
